The KLOE experiment at the Frascati phi factory, DaPhine, has collected similar to500 pb(-1), i.e. 1.5 x 10(9) phi decays. At the phi factory it is possible to select pure K-L and K-S beams. Although the integrated luminosity is insufficient for precision tests of the CP, T symmetries in kaon decays, a wide number of topics in kaon and hadronic physics are accessible from the largest sample of (D decays at rest collected so far. The cross section sigma(e(+)e(-) --> pi(+)pi(-)gamma) below 1 GeV, relevant for the precise evaluation of the muon magnetic moment, has been measured with a statistical accuracy better than 1%. For the K-S, we obtained the ratio of the branching fractions Gamma(K-S --> pi(+)pi(-)(gamma))/Gamma(K-S --> pi(0)pi(0)) = (2.239 +/- 0.003(stat) +/- 0.015(syst)), fully inclusive of the pipigamma final state. The analysis of the similar to20,000 K-S semileptonic decays K-S --> piev is being finalized providing precise measurements of both, the K-S semileptonic branching ratio, and Re x(+), i.e. the DeltaS = DeltaQ rule violation parameter. For the K-L, we obtained the ratio Gamma(K-L --> gammagamma)/Gamma(K-L --> pi(0)pi(0)pi(0)) = (2.80 +/- 0.02(stat) +/- 0.02(syst)) x 10(-3), of interest to Chiral Perturbation Theory (ChPT), as well as preliminary results on the branching ratios to other decay modes. In particular, our measurements of the semileptonic decays of both, neutral, and charged kaons will improve the precision of the CKM matrix element V-us, clarifying the present disagreement between different experiments. The phi radiative decays, both in scalar and pseudo-scalar mesons, have been analyzed giving new measurements of the eta - eta' mixing angle, and of the phi --> a(0)(980)gamma, phi --> f(0)(980)gamma branching ratios.
